The Alchemy of Alcohol: Unveiling the Secrets of Liqueur Production

Liqueurs, those enchanting concoctions, hold a mystique that draws us in. To craft these delectable beverages requires a delicate balance of art and science, a true alchemy that transforms humble ingredients into something extraordinary. From the careful selection of fruits ripe to the precise infusion of herbs, each step is meticulously executed.

The result? A symphony of flavors that tantalize the palate and ignite the imagination.

This alchemy begins with the base spirit, often a clear vodka which serves as the canvas upon which these flavorful masterpieces are painted. Then, ensues the infusion process, where fruits, seeds, and extracts are steeped in the spirit, slowly releasing their aromas and essence. This careful extraction imbues the liqueur with its distinctive character, creating a spectrum of tastes from the sweetness of amaretto to the herbal complexity of Chartreuse.

A Toast to Tradition: The History and Cultural Significance of Liqueurs

From ancient rituals to modern-day celebrations, liqueurs have held a special place in human culture for centuries. Its origins can be traced back to medieval Europe, where monks developed techniques for infusing spirits with fruits. Liqueurs quickly gained popularity as both a delicious indulgence and a healing remedy.

Over history, liqueurs have transformed alongside cultural trends, taking on unique flavors and styles in different regions of the world. In France, for example, cognac-based liqueurs like Chambord are renowned for their elegance and sophistication. Meanwhile, Italy's rich tradition of liqueur production has given rise to bold flavors like limoncello and amaro.
